Job Description

Wurzak Hotel Group is looking for a Steward to support the Culinary department at our gorgeous property, Sheraton Valley Forge. This position is responsible for maintaining cleanliness and sanitation standards for china, glassware, tableware, cooking utensils, etc., using machine and manual cleaning methods.

The Company operates 24 hours a day and 7 days a week, so operational demands require variations in shift days, starting and ending times, and hours worked in a week.

Essential Functions
Reasonable accommodations may be made to enable individuals with disabilities to perform the essential functions.
• Sort and rinse dirty dishes, glass, tableware and other cooking utensils and place them in racks to send through dish machine
• Sort and stack clean dishes
• Wash pots, pans and trays by hand
• Remove trash and garbage to dumpster
• Set up or break down dishwashing area
• Fill/empty soak tubs with cleaning/sanitizing solutions
• Sweep/mop floors
• Assemble/disassemble dish machine
• Sweep up trash around exterior of restaurant and garbage dumpster
• General restaurant and restroom cleaning as directed
• Wipe up any spills to ensure kitchen floors remain dry and clean
• Observe adherence to all safety protocols including correct use of clean supplies
• Consistent professional and positive attitude and actions when communicating with guests and associates.
• Comply with policies and procedures
• Practice safe work habits and comply with sanitary, safety, security and emergency procedures
• Write shift reports including reports on any incidents of theft, accidents or injuries when assigned
• Any other tasks/duties as requested by management

About WHG
Wurzak Hotel Group (WHG) is a Philadelphia based owner, developer and operator of premium branded full service, extended stay and focus service hotels. WHG’s core expertise is its unique ability to develop and operate hotels and food and beverage outlets in an entrepreneurial manner maximizing returns on the investment and developing long term relationships with our guests.
WHG has earned and maintains its competitive advantage by developing talent within the organization who embody the same entrepreneurial spirit of our leadership team and who seek to create value through tireless innovation, tight focus on the operational details and uncompromised guest satisfaction. Wurzak Hotel Group has a proven track record of developing and managing hospitality assets for over 30 years and continues to be recognized as one of the region’s top hospitality companies.
